Output 8669054e645da4ec3171ee37eb59ff72a0c7ee7ded35bb0a4b76edabbf8731b2:66
- value
- 137590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a04d7af3eaffe40072e9883a1ba808ff436b99f OP_EQUAL
- address
- 3QUzexwqHFT3HVCzg9y5Z6xKywhj5X7knB
- transaction
- 8669054e645da4ec3171ee37eb59ff72a0c7ee7ded35bb0a4b76edabbf8731b2
- confirmations
- 265560
- spent
- true